Full-Time Arbiters: Adjust to Number of Participants

Having qualified arbiters present at your chess tournament is essential for maintaining fair play and rule adherence. The number of full-time arbiters needed will vary based on the total number of participants. It's crucial to have enough arbiters to oversee games and handle any issues or violations effectively.

Chess Sets: Relying on Participant Count

Chess sets are a must-have for any chess tournament. The quantity of sets required will depend on the total number of players involved in the competition. It's important to have sufficient chess sets available for all participants to prevent delays.

Chess Clocks: Tailored to Participant Numbers

Chess clocks are used to monitor the time each player spends on their moves during games. The number of clocks needed will be determined by the total number of players in the tournament. It's vital to have an adequate number of chess clocks to ensure games stay within the designated time limits.

Tables & Chairs: Based on Participant Numbers

Tables and chairs are essential for creating a comfortable and stable gaming environment for players. The quantity of tables and chairs needed will depend on the total number of participants and available space. Ensuring there are enough tables and chairs for everyone will allow players to set up their equipment comfortably.

Score Sheets & Carbon: Tied to Participant Numbers

Score sheets and carbon copies are used to track players' moves during games. The amount needed will correspond to the total number of participants in the tournament. Having a sufficient supply of score sheets and carbons will guarantee accurate records for all matches.

Notice Board: Vital for Displaying Information

A notice board is crucial for presenting pairings, results, and important announcements throughout the tournament. Designating a specific area for the notice board will help keep players and spectators informed and organized. Having at least one notice board or designated display area is essential for clarity.
